Common use of Integration; Counterparts; Electronic Signatures Clause in Contracts

Integration; Counterparts; Electronic Signatures. This Agreement contains the entire agreement between the parties and supersedes all prior written or oral discussions or agreements regarding the same subject. The Agreement may be executed in any number of counterparts, each of which so executed shall be deemed to be an original and such counterparts shall together constitute but one and the same Agreement. Any party shall be entitled to sign and transmit electronic signatures to this Agreement (whether by facsimile, .pdf, or electronic mail transmission), and any such signature shall be binding on the party whose name is contained therein. Any party providing an electronic signature to this Agreement agrees to promptly execute and deliver to the other parties, upon request, an original signed Agreement.
